モネロ(XMR)技術的特徴をわかりやすく解説!



モネロ(XMR)技術の特徴をわかりやすく解説!


モネロ(XMR)技術の特徴をわかりやすく解説!

モネロ(Monero)は、プライバシー保護に重点を置いた暗号通貨です。ビットコインなどの他の暗号通貨と比較して、取引の匿名性を高めるための高度な技術を採用しています。本稿では、モネロの技術的な特徴を詳細に解説し、その仕組みと利点について理解を深めます。

1. モネロの基本概念

モネロは、2014年にNicolas van Saberhagenによって開発されました。その名前は、スペイン語で「貨幣」を意味する「Monero」に由来します。モネロの主な目的は、取引のプライバシーを保護し、誰が、いつ、どれだけの金額を取引したかを隠蔽することです。これは、ビットコインなどの他の暗号通貨では、取引履歴がブロックチェーン上に公開されるため、プライバシーが侵害される可能性があるという課題を解決するためのものです。

2. リング署名(Ring Signatures)

モネロのプライバシー保護技術の中核をなすのが、リング署名です。リング署名は、複数の署名者の署名をまとめて一つの署名として表現する技術です。これにより、実際の署名者が誰であるかを特定することが困難になります。具体的には、取引を行う際に、自分の公開鍵だけでなく、ブロックチェーン上の他のユーザーの公開鍵を複数選択し、それらを含めたリングを作成します。署名者は、このリングの中から誰が実際に署名したかを隠蔽することができます。

リング署名の仕組みは、数学的な複雑さを利用しています。署名者は、リングに含まれるすべての公開鍵を使用して署名を作成しますが、どの公開鍵が実際に署名に使用されたかを検証することは非常に困難です。これにより、取引の送信者が誰であるかを隠蔽することができます。

3. ステールスアドレス(Stealth Addresses)

ステールスアドレスは、受信者のアドレスを隠蔽するための技術です。通常の暗号通貨では、取引の受信アドレスがブロックチェーン上に公開されますが、ステールスアドレスを使用することで、受信者は取引ごとに異なるアドレスを生成し、自分の本来のアドレスを隠蔽することができます。これにより、受信者のアドレスが取引履歴から追跡されるのを防ぐことができます。

ステールスアドレスの仕組みは、ワンタイムアドレスを使用することに基づいています。受信者は、取引ごとに新しいワンタイムアドレスを生成し、そのアドレスを送信者に通知します。送信者は、このワンタイムアドレスに資金を送信しますが、このアドレスは受信者の本来のアドレスとは異なるため、取引履歴から受信者のアドレスを特定することは困難です。

4. リングCT(Ring Confidential Transactions)

リングCTは、取引金額を隠蔽するための技術です。ビットコインなどの他の暗号通貨では、取引金額がブロックチェーン上に公開されますが、リングCTを使用することで、取引金額を隠蔽することができます。リングCTは、ペティット・ゼロ知識証明(Pedersen commitment)と呼ばれる暗号技術を使用しています。これにより、取引金額を暗号化し、ブロックチェーン上に公開されたとしても、取引金額を解読することが困難になります。

リングCTの仕組みは、取引金額を暗号化し、その暗号化された値をブロックチェーン上に公開することに基づいています。検証者は、取引が有効であることを確認できますが、実際の取引金額を知ることはできません。これにより、取引金額のプライバシーを保護することができます。

5. ダイナミックブロックサイズ

モネロは、ダイナミックブロックサイズを採用しています。これは、ブロックサイズが固定ではなく、ネットワークの状況に応じて自動的に調整されることを意味します。これにより、ネットワークの混雑を緩和し、取引の処理速度を向上させることができます。ビットコインなどの他の暗号通貨では、ブロックサイズが固定されているため、ネットワークが混雑すると取引の処理速度が低下する可能性があります。

モネロのダイナミックブロックサイズは、ブロックの生成時間に基づいて調整されます。ブロックの生成時間が目標時間よりも長くなると、ブロックサイズが大きくなり、ブロックの生成時間が目標時間よりも短くなると、ブロックサイズが小さくなります。これにより、ネットワークの安定性を維持し、取引の処理速度を最適化することができます。

6. PoW(プルーフ・オブ・ワーク)

モネロは、プルーフ・オブ・ワーク(PoW)と呼ばれるコンセンサスアルゴリズムを使用しています。PoWは、ネットワークに参加するノードが、複雑な計算問題を解くことでブロックを生成する仕組みです。これにより、ネットワークのセキュリティを確保し、不正な取引を防ぐことができます。モネロは、CryptoNightと呼ばれるPoWアルゴリズムを使用しています。CryptoNightは、CPUマイニングに最適化されており、ASICマイナーによる支配を防ぐように設計されています。

モネロのPoWアルゴリズムは、メモリハードな特徴を持っています。これは、計算問題を解くために大量のメモリが必要であることを意味します。これにより、ASICマイナーのような専用のハードウェアを使用することが困難になり、CPUマイニングによる分散型マイニングを促進することができます。

7. モネロの利点と課題

モネロの主な利点は、高いプライバシー保護能力です。リング署名、ステールスアドレス、リングCTなどの技術により、取引の送信者、受信者、取引金額を隠蔽することができます。これにより、ユーザーは匿名で取引を行うことができ、プライバシーを保護することができます。

しかし、モネロにはいくつかの課題も存在します。まず、取引のサイズが大きくなる傾向があります。リング署名やステールスアドレスなどの技術を使用すると、取引のデータサイズが大きくなり、ブロックチェーンの容量を圧迫する可能性があります。また、モネロの取引所での取り扱いが限られているため、他の暗号通貨と比較して流動性が低い場合があります。さらに、モネロのプライバシー保護機能は、違法な活動に利用される可能性があるという懸念もあります。

8. モネロの将来展望

モネロは、プライバシー保護に重点を置いた暗号通貨として、今後も成長していく可能性があります。プライバシーに対する意識が高まるにつれて、モネロのような匿名性の高い暗号通貨の需要は増加すると予想されます。また、モネロの開発コミュニティは、常に新しい技術を開発し、モネロのプライバシー保護能力を向上させるための努力を続けています。

モネロの将来展望は、規制環境や技術開発の進展によって左右される可能性があります。政府による暗号通貨規制が強化された場合、モネロの利用が制限される可能性があります。また、新しいプライバシー保護技術が開発された場合、モネロの優位性が失われる可能性があります。しかし、モネロの開発コミュニティは、これらの課題に対応し、モネロのプライバシー保護能力を維持するための努力を続けるでしょう。

まとめ

モネロは、プライバシー保護に重点を置いた革新的な暗号通貨です。リング署名、ステールスアドレス、リングCTなどの高度な技術を採用することで、取引の匿名性を高め、ユーザーのプライバシーを保護することができます。モネロには、取引のサイズが大きい、流動性が低い、違法な活動に利用される可能性があるなどの課題も存在しますが、プライバシーに対する意識が高まるにつれて、今後も成長していく可能性があります。モネロは、プライバシーを重視するユーザーにとって、魅力的な選択肢となるでしょう。


前の記事

ビットコインのプライバシー保護技術最新動向

次の記事

ヘデラ(HBAR)で稼ぐ!初心者のための投資戦略